What is Perry-McCall Construction?
Headquartered in Jacksonville, Florida, Perry-McCall Construction operates as a versatile general contractor with a deep portfolio spanning multiple high-stakes sectors. The firm provides specialized construction solutions for assisted living, corporate, entertainment, healthcare, government, education, industrial, and religious facilities. Their market authority is evidenced by high-profile projects such as the Medical Examiners Office for the City of Jacksonville and the South Chiller Plant at Embry-Riddle Aeronautical University.
